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of negative pressure aquarium technology, and in particular to a dual-liquid-level negative pressure aquarium. Background Technology
[0002] Currently, most of the interactive negative pressure aquariums installed in marine parks are made of acrylic, constructed from acrylic sheets of varying thicknesses from 30 to 80 mm. The negative pressure height is only a few tens of centimeters, with a maximum of no more than 1 meter. For safety reasons, the acrylic thickness is excessive, resulting in a high cost.
[0003] Currently, in the case of a dual-level negative pressure aquarium, a large amount of fish excrement accumulates at the bottom of the aquarium after prolonged use, making cleaning very troublesome and impractical. In addition, the internal components of the current dual-level negative pressure aquarium are all integrated, making it inconvenient to disassemble for cleaning or replacement, further reducing its practicality. [0020] Example 1, such as Figure 1-4 As shown, this utility model provides a dual-level negative pressure aquarium, including a first aquarium body 1, a second aquarium body 2 inside the first aquarium body 1, an air extractor 4 inside the second aquarium body 2, a low-level detector 6 installed on the inner wall of the first aquarium body 1, a high-level detector 5 installed above the low-level detector 6 on the inner wall of the first aquarium body 1, a baffle plate 7 located below the second aquarium body 2 inside the first aquarium body 1, a collection box 16 placed against the bottom of the baffle plate 7 inside the first aquarium body 1, a water outlet pipe 18 fixed to one end of the collection box 16, and the end of the water outlet pipe 18 away from the collection box 16 passing through the first aquarium body 1 and located outside the first aquarium body 1.
[0021] The overall effect of Embodiment 1 is as follows: by operating the air extractor 4, air is drawn from the second aquarium body 2, creating a negative pressure inside the second aquarium body 2, which draws water from the first aquarium body 1. Through the high-level detector 5 and the low-level detector 6, when the water level in the first aquarium body 1 is lower than the low-level detector 6, the low-level detector 6 controls the externally connected water outlet device to replenish water to the first aquarium body 1. Conversely, when the water level in the first aquarium body 1 is higher than the high-level detector 5, the high-level detector 5 controls the externally connected water outlet device to stop adding water. The barrier plate 7 allows fish excrement to fall through the gaps in the barrier plate 7 while preventing fish from entering the subsequent collection box 16. The collection box 16 allows for centralized collection of fish excrement for easy cleaning. The water outlet pipe 18 allows for drainage.

[0024] Working principle: When this device is in use, the air extractor 4 evacuates air from the second aquarium body 2, creating a negative pressure inside. This causes water to be drawn from the first aquarium body 1. Through the high-level detector 5 and low-level detector 6, when the water level in the first aquarium body 1 is lower than the low-level detector 6, the low-level detector 6 controls the external water outlet device to replenish water to the first aquarium body 1. Conversely, when the water level in the first aquarium body 1 is higher than the high-level detector 5, the high-level detector 5 controls the external water outlet device to stop adding water. The baffle plates 7 allow fish excrement to fall through the gaps and into the collection box 16. When the first aquarium body 1 is filled with water through the outlet pipe 18... When draining water, the user can directly remove the second bolt 22 to remove the base plate 17 and collection box 16, allowing for direct flushing of the excrement in the collection box 16 without the user needing to reach into the aquarium to retrieve it, thus enhancing practicality. Additionally, by unscrewing the first bolt 14, the second slider 12 is no longer fixed to the first aquarium body 1, allowing the user to directly remove the first aquarium body 1 for replacement or cleaning. Furthermore, when the first aquarium body 1 is removed, the second slider 12 no longer limits the handle 10, allowing the user to directly remove the barrier plate 7 through the handle 10 to plant or clean the planting box 8 fixed at its top, further enhancing practicality. The flange 19 facilitates connection to external wastewater treatment systems.
